Design an oscillator circuit using the arrangement in Fig. 4 (namely, find C+1=C+2). Fig. 4 shows that we are using a pair of 2N5485 JFET. However, you are supplied with two J112 (or J113) to be used here. Use datasheet for J112 (or J113) to determine the needed capacitances. The oscillation frequency is considered to be 1 MHz. Use L₁ = L₂ = 112 μH. Furthermore, assume Cr=200 pF and Re = 300 . Is the assumption Cf >> CGS&CGD valid?
